Louis Pacha (172478978) Central Texas Obituaries Temple Daily Telegram Aug 19, 2005 Louis Edward Pacha Services for Louis Edward Pacha, 79, of Temple will be at 10 a.m. Saturday at Harper-Talasek Funeral Home in Temple with Bob Kelley officiating. Mr. Pacha died Wednesday, Aug. 17, in a local hospital. He was born in Holland to Antone Joseph and Bertha Pacha. He grew up in the agricultural areas of Bell County. He served in the Army as an MP sergeant during World War II. He married Evelyn Hargrove on Aug. 22, 1953, in Temple. He owned Pacha Appliance repair and for many years worked repairing appliances at Casey's Furniture in Temple. He was featured in the news as one of Maytag's "Lonely Repairman." He was a member of VFW Post 1820 and the Sheriff's Association of Texas. He was preceded in death by his wife in 1996. Survivors are a daughter, Lisa Edmonds of Temple; two sisters, Emma Pacha of Temple and Mary Massar of Holland; two granddaughters; and a great-grandchild.
